Financing Without a score Check: Interest Rates Explained

Securing the loan without the CIBIL check can seem beneficial, especially for individuals with thin credit background. However, it's vital to understand that these financings typically come with higher interest. Banks perceive some riskier borrower when credit data isn't available, so they account for this with increased interest. Expect charges to range significantly, potentially beginning at roughly 2% to 5% higher than standard costs offered to those with positive credit scores. Factors influencing the exact interest include the loan principal, repayment terms, and the customer's overall monetary standing. Thoroughly assess offers from multiple creditors to find the best deal you can be eligible for.
